What to know about Personalisation
Personalisation has become a central focus for businesses aiming to enhance customer experiences across various industries. As showcased in recent stories, it involves leveraging data, AI, and emerging technologies to create tailored interactions that meet individual consumer preferences and expectations in real time.
From loyalty programmes adapting to economic challenges, to AI-powered marketing and customer service innovations, personalisation drives increased engagement, loyalty, and revenue. Organisations are advancing their strategies by integrating first-party data platforms, utilising generative AI, and employing intelligent tools that respect privacy while delivering meaningful and empathetic experiences.
Readers exploring this tag will discover insights into how personalisation transforms marketing, retail, ecommerce, travel, and customer experience, highlighting challenges and solutions that enable brands to stay relevant and competitive in a rapidly evolving digital landscape.
